Output 53ac277825106d6182bd611d4d4ab66cfb3a85a67b9cd5612f4926487ec18c9a:1

value
683683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cfc8b5c3411fe39f18b17f9114af10d8ba0895 OP_EQUAL
address
3HMUPS7aRAGz1xh17EVzXDB1xTBmNNtSaD
transaction
53ac277825106d6182bd611d4d4ab66cfb3a85a67b9cd5612f4926487ec18c9a